Ligue 1 Report: Paris Saint-Germain v Nantes 14 March 2021

Result: Paris Saint-Germain 1-2 Nantes

Date: 14 March 2021

Venue: Parc di Princes

Paris Saint-Germain missed the chance to go top of Ligue 1 after suffering a 2-1 loss to Nantes in the French capital on Sunday evening.

Mauricio Pochettino dropped Alessandro Florenzi, Leandro Paredes, Layvin Kurzawa, Idrissa Gueye and Mauro Icardi from the 1-1 draw with FC Barcelona in the UEFA Champions League last 16 during the week.

PSG leaned towards the front on 11 minutes after Angel Di Maria worked an opening from the right-side to see goalkeeper Alban Lafont palm for a corner-kick.

It was all the Parisans and the chances kept coming their midway in the midway point when Rafinha narrowly headed a cross over the top.

A fantastic close-range save from Lafont a little later denied Kylian Mbappe the chance to double their lead after running onto a ball into space.

Nantes succumbed to the hosts' pursuit minutes inside halftime after Julian Draxler charged at the edge of the area to finish off a smooth delivery.

Mbappe gave the visitors another threat two minutes from the interval after he turned two defenders to drag wide of the mark.

La Maison enjoyed no time on the ball and furthermore clear-cut opening, which PSG managed successfully shortly before the break.

Pochettino introduced a change minutes following the start of the second half as Rafinha made way for striker Icardi.

Nantes didn't wait long to draw level through a well-taken strike on 59 minutes by Randal Kolo, giving PSG goalkeeper Keylor Navas no chance.

La Maison turned the match around in the final 20 minutes when a ball from Kolo spotted Moses Simon to do the rest with a composed finish from inside the box following a counter-attack.

PSG pushed for the equaliser inside the remaining minutes of the match, but the visitors closed shop for a 2-1 win.
